Job Description
The Mgr of Med/Surg is accountable and responsible for the effective delivery of competent, compassionate, and efficient patient care in the Medical Surgical Unit.
The Manager assumes 24/7 leadership responsibility for the assigned unit in collaboration with the division director. The manager is responsible for the development of patient care programs, policies and procedures. The manager will participate with administration, management, medical staff, clinical leaders and frontline employees in the decision-making structures and processes. The manager will implement an effective, ongoing program to measure assess, and improve the reliability and quality of care delivered to patients. The manager is responsible for budgeting and managing supplies, equipment and personnel for the assigned unit. The manager will ensure that the staff has sufficient information to comply with corporate compliance program. The manager will also be expected to maintain clinical skills and assist with patient care as necessary.
